Southwest Airlines Celebrates America’s 250th Anniversary with Independence One

Southwest Airlines recently unveiled its 'Independence One' aircraft, honoring America's upcoming 250th anniversary with a distinctive design and commitment to community service.

Southwest Airlines unveiled its ‘Independence One’ aircraft on April 29, 2026, at Philadelphia International Airport, celebrating America’s 250th anniversary. The aircraft showcases a striking red, white, and blue design that honors the spirit of the nation.

The special tail number ‘1776’ pays homage to the year of American independence. The aircraft also features significant phrases like ‘life, liberty and the pursuit of happiness,’ alongside thirteen stars representing the original colonies. This unique design reflects not only the airline’s heritage but also its commitment to connecting communities.

On its inaugural flight from Dallas to Philadelphia, Independence One received a celebratory water cannon reception. Bob Jordan, CEO of Southwest Airlines, expressed pride in being part of this historic celebration. He stated, “Southwest is proud to be a part of the 250th national celebration and to honor the same spirit of innovation, resilience, and optimism that has shaped our country and our Company.”

As the official airline for America250, Southwest Airlines plans to invest up to $250,000 in volunteerism initiatives throughout the year. In 2025 alone, Southwest employees contributed an impressive 180,000 hours of volunteer service. Rosie Rios from America250 highlighted how this initiative reflects the spirit of freedom and opportunity that defines America.

Key facts about Independence One:

  • The aircraft features a red, white, and blue paint scheme with ‘1776’ written in giant quill script.
  • The phrase ‘life, liberty and the pursuit of happiness’ is included on the aircraft.
  • Thirteen stars on the fuselage denote the thirteen original colonies.
  • The aircraft has a special ‘1776’ tail number.

This initiative not only marks an important milestone for Southwest Airlines but also emphasizes its ongoing mission to foster volunteerism within communities across America. As Jordan put it, “It’s a symbol of what it means to give America the freedom to fly.” The airline’s legacy continues as it serves over 121 airports nationwide and carried 134 million customers in 2025.

Independence One will make special stops throughout the year as part of various celebrations marking this significant anniversary. Further details about upcoming events are expected as Southwest Airlines continues its commitment to community engagement and support.
